Eastview will provide a Summer School program from June 16–July 10 (17 days) for Eastview High School students wishing to earn credit towards graduation.  Class will not be held on Thursday July 3 or Friday July 4 in observation of the Independence Day holiday.  Courses offered will include English, Math, Social Studies, Science, and Wellness for grades 9–12.  The students can also prepare for Basic Standards Testing through their summer school courses.  These courses will be for make-up credit only.  The courses will run Monday through Friday with each day organized into three periods:  Period 1 from 7:30–9:15, Period 2 from 9:20–11:05 and Period 3 from 11:10–12:55.  Each period is worth the equivalent of one quarter.  A student, therefore, could make up as much as 2.25 credits or three quarter length courses if he/she signs up for all three periods.  Registration forms are available in the Guidance Office.  Any questions in regard to the summer school program should be directed to program director Thomas Sharp at thomas.sharp@district196.org
